Demand creates substantial growth for BRM Real Estate Division

3rd July 2023

Regional Law Firm BRM Solicitors can proudly state that it is one of the region's strongest property departments with the recent recruitment taking them to the 24 lawyers.

BRM's 24-strong team now includes eight directors and counts Woodall Group, Gleeson Homes, Reef Group and Global Brands among its clients.

Whilst the real estate industry is facing challenges, nimble-footed clients continue to succeed by meeting private and local authority housing needs, taking advantage of permitted development rights, developing large-scale storage and distribution sites, embracing cloud data and battery storage projects, refocussing office space to hybrid working, assisting regeneration of city centres by re-gearing and upgrading retail offerings and encompassing science, educational and tech sectors. 

To meet changing and increased client requirements, BRM has recruited and trained its team to create one of the largest property legal departments in the region.
